Default Rough country 3'' series II lift?

http://www.roughcountry.com/jeep_xj_3x.html
is this foreal? because thats a great price.
questions:
what else do i need to purchase to complete this kit?
is a sye a must?
and if i added coil spacers and shackles would it sit higher and be fine?

I would upgrade and get full leaf packs. AAL will sag eventually. If you're gonna add shackles and coil spacers why not just do the 4.5 in lift. You may or may not need an sye or tc drop with a 3 in lift. You will need it for sure with a 4.5 in lift along with longer brake lines. You will also have to relocate your track bar or get an adjustable track bar. Check out this thread lots of good info for you to look through.
